JD or Marco? Trump asking advisers about 2028
Summary
President Trump is discussing potential successors for the 2028 presidential race within his party. He often asks advisers whether JD Vance or Marco Rubio would be better suited for a leadership role. Trump favors Vance but also praises Rubio's work as Secretary of State.Key Facts
- President Donald Trump often talks with advisers about who should lead the Republican ticket in 2028: JD Vance or Marco Rubio.
- Trump currently sees JD Vance as a potential successor and favors him, which is why Vance is his vice president.
- Trump has also praised Marco Rubio for his role as Secretary of State and national security adviser.
- Rubio has voiced support for Vance, even willing to back him if he runs for president.
- Trump has joked about Rubio's strong diplomatic skills, which he complements with Vance's toughness.
- Vance plans to engage more in public campaigns as the Republican National Committee's finance chair.
- Trump strategically mentions both Rubio and Vance to keep options open and maintain influence within his team.
